随笔分类 -  21.Redis

 
【面试】【Redis】Redis面试
摘要:Redis是什么 面试官:你先来说下redis是什么吧 我:(这不就是总结下redis的定义和特点嘛)Redis是C语言开发的一个开源的(遵从BSD协议)高性能键值对(key-value)的内存数据库,可以用作数据库、缓存、消息中间件等。它是一种NoSQL(not-only sql,泛指非关系型数据 阅读全文
posted @ 2020-05-21 09:27 zzsuje 阅读(397) 评论(0) 推荐(0)
【概念】【redis】Redis的三个框架:Jedis,Redisson,Lettuce【p12】
摘要:Jedis api 在线网址:http://tool.oschina.net/uploads/apidocs/redis/clients/jedis/Jedis.html redisson 官网地址:https://redisson.org/ redisson git项目地址:https://git 阅读全文
posted @ 2020-05-20 10:56 zzsuje 阅读(205) 评论(0) 推荐(0)
【概念】【redis】Redis的主从复制和哨兵模式【p12】
摘要:搭建主从复制 简介 主机数据更新后根据配置和策略,自动同步到备机的master/slaver机制,mester以写为主,slaver以读为主。原则上是配从不配主。 搭建主从复制 新建三个文件夹:redis8000、redis8001、redis8002 将redis.conf复制到redis8000 阅读全文
posted @ 2020-05-14 15:13 zzsuje 阅读(196) 评论(0) 推荐(0)
【概念】【Redis】Redsi的持久化机制【P12】
摘要:RDB 简介 RDB是Redis用来进行持久化的一种方式,是把当前内存中的数据集快照写入磁盘,也就是快照(数据库中所有键值对数据)。恢复时是将快照文件直接读到内存里。 两种触发方式 手动触发 save: 该命令会阻塞redis,在sava期间,不能执行其他命令,直到持久化完成。 bgsave: 该命 阅读全文
posted @ 2020-05-14 15:05 zzsuje 阅读(149) 评论(0) 推荐(0)
【概念】Redis缓存的雪崩、穿透、击穿
摘要:缓存雪崩 -产生原因 我们都知道Redis不可能把所有的数据都缓存起来,所以Redis需要对数据设置过期时间,并采用的是惰性删除(放任键过期不管,但是每次从键空间中获取键时,都检查取得的键是否过期,如果过期的话,就删除该键;如果没有过期,那就返回该键)+定期删除两种策略对过期键删除。如果缓存数据设置 阅读全文
posted @ 2020-05-14 14:34 zzsuje 阅读(189) 评论(0) 推荐(0)
【项目搭建】【Redis】完整SpringBoot Cache整合redis缓存(二)
摘要:名称 解释 Cache 缓存接口,定义缓存操作。实现有:RedisCache、EhCacheCache、ConcurrentMapCache等 CacheManager 缓存管理器,管理各种缓存(cache)组件 @Cacheable 主要针对方法配置,能够根据方法的请求参数对其进行缓存 @Cach 阅读全文
posted @ 2020-05-14 13:35 zzsuje 阅读(390) 评论(0) 推荐(0)
【项目搭建】SpringBoot整合redis缓存(一)
摘要:准备工作: 1.Linux系统 2.安装redis(也可以安装docker,然后再docker中装redis,本文章就直接用Linux安装redis做演示) redis下载地址:http://download.redis.io/releases/redis-4.0.14.tar.gz 找到redis 阅读全文
posted @ 2020-05-14 11:20 zzsuje 阅读(588) 评论(0) 推荐(0)
【项目搭建】springboot快速整合Redis
摘要:在pom.xml中加入 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-data-redis</artifactId> </dependency> 在applicatio 阅读全文
posted @ 2020-05-13 17:38 zzsuje 阅读(453) 评论(0) 推荐(0)
【环境搭建】Windows安装Redis(转!)
摘要:目录 一、关于Redis二、安装和配置Redis三、客户端使用Redis四、Redis注意和其他 转自https://www.cnblogs.com/wxjnew/p/9160855.html “现在我已经走到了人生的十字路口边了,我相信,在已走过的人生道路中,我一直知道其中哪一条是正确的,是的,我 阅读全文
posted @ 2020-05-13 14:24 zzsuje 阅读(274) 评论(0) 推荐(0)